About the Role
 
Our client is seeking an experienced, passionate, and motivated Children's Care Home Manager between the ages of 8 - 18 years old. To lead and develop a high-quality residential children's home in Coventry. This is a key leadership role, responsible for ensuring the home delivers outstanding care and positive outcomes for children and young people with emotional and behavioural needs.
 
The successful candidate will be registered with Ofsted and will play a pivotal role in creating a safe, nurturing and supportive environment where children can thrive.

Key Responsibilities
 
Provide strong, inspirational leadership to the staff team
Ensure the home meets and exceeds Ofsted regulations and Quality Standards
Register with Ofsted as the Registered Manager
Develop, implement and monitor individual care plans and risk assessments
Promote positive behaviour management and safeguarding practices
Recruit, train, supervise, and develop staff
Manage budgets, rotas, and resources effectively
Build positive relationships with children, families, social workers and external professionals
Lead on inspections, audits and continuous improvement   
Essential Requirements
 
Level 5 Diploma in Leadership and Management for Residential Childcare (or equivalent)
Minimum 2 years' experience in a management or deputy role within a children's residential setting
Strong knowledge of Ofsted regulations, safeguarding and children's legislation
Proven leadership and people management skills
Ability to manage challenging behaviour in a trauma-informed way
Excellent communication, organisational and problem-solving skills
Full UK driving licence   
Desirable
 
Experience managing an Ofsted-rated home
Background in supporting children with EBD, trauma, or complex needs
Experience leading a home through an Ofsted inspection
